Zr6CuBi2 is an intermetallic compound combining zirconium, copper, and bismuth, representing a research-phase material from the zirconium alloy family. This compound is primarily of scientific interest rather than established in high-volume production, with potential applications in specialized metallurgical research, thermal management systems, or advanced functional materials where the unique phase stability and elemental combination may offer distinctive properties. Engineers would consider this material in experimental or emerging technologies where conventional zirconium alloys are insufficient, though availability and processing maturity remain limiting factors compared to commercial alternatives.
